Hello All,

Lately I've had numerous people message me about people using or sharing my photos on Facebook. After exploring, the sheer amount of times they've been shared is insane. Thus, I have almost given up on trying to stop it. Given social media these days, I won't win. However, I do have conditions in which I will fight it. Firstly, my copyright should ALWAYS be displayed. I'm working to come up with a larger one that is harder to remove and can direct them to me personally easier. Secondly my photos shall NEVER be used for commercial purposes unless I've given my permission or they have been purchased. If you see them being used commercially, please message me. I'd rather double check then it go un-investigated. Otherwise as long as the copyright is displayed and people are just sharing it because the discus/and photos look good (ok shameless plug LOL) then I don't have a real problem with it.

Matt, I know how you feel. I have already taken a few people to task over this. In fairness to FB one of my images was being used as someone's logo in what looked to be a commercial operation, I lodged a complaint using their procedures and the image was removed. I had written to the people concerned too, just asking them to credit me with the photo - not for money - and they were too dumb to do so or acknowledge my communication. I now make it a point to go after any commercial operation that uses my images without permission as in 99% of times they know exactly what they are doing and it is just cynical.
